Factors Influencing Car Insurance Rates for Seniors
Several factors can affect how much you pay for car insurance, even when discounts are available. For seniors in 2026, these include:
- Driving Record: A clean driving record helps keep premiums low.
- Vehicle Type and Age: The make, model, and age of your vehicle impact your insurance rate.
- Location: Insurance rates vary by region due to factors like population density and crime rates.
- Usage: How often you use your vehicle and for what purpose can influence the cost.
Expert Tips for Seniors Choosing Car Insurance
Choosing the right insurance can be daunting. Here are some expert tips to help seniors in Australia make informed decisions:
- Compare Different Insurers: Don’t settle on the first quote; shop around and compare offers from different insurers.
- Assess Your Coverage Needs: Consider what kind of coverage you actually need versus optional extras that you may not use.
- Read the Fine Print: Always check the terms and conditions, paying close attention to what is and isn’t covered.
- Reach Out for Assistance: If you're unsure or need help understanding the terms, consult with a trusted advisor or family member.
